Study Units
The Scaffolding Level 1 Course includes the following key study areas:
- Introduction to Scaffolding
Overview of the scaffolding trade, industry standards, and types of scaffolding systems. - Scaffold Tools and Equipment
Identification, safe handling, and maintenance of basic scaffolding tools and materials. - Site Safety and Risk Management
Understanding site hazards, personal protective equipment (PPE), and accident prevention. - Scaffold Components and Terminology
Names, functions, and proper use of scaffold tubes, fittings, boards, and braces. - Basic Erection and Dismantling Procedures
Safe and supervised practices for setting up and taking down scaffold structures. - Working at Heights
Fall protection systems, safe access methods, and emergency procedures. - Communication and Teamwork
Coordination with site teams, following instructions, and site conduct.
Learning Outcomes
Upon successful completion of the course, participants will be able to:
- Understand the fundamental principles of scaffolding.
- Identify scaffold components and assemble basic structures under supervision.
- Follow safety procedures and use PPE correctly while working at heights.
- Recognize common site hazards and respond appropriately.
- Work as part of a scaffolding team on construction sites.
- Comply with site rules and scaffold safety guidelines.
